All Bachelor programs take 4 academic years (13 semesters) except Bachelor (Hons) Accounting, which is takes 5 2/3 years (17 semesters) to complete while the Diploma takes 4 academic years (12 semesters) to complete. With credit transfer, students may able to complete their studies in shorter period.

Application is open throughout the year for all programmes. However, intakes are on a semester basis in January, May and September. Application Procedures 1) Complete the OUM application form (application form can be obtained from OUM website) 2) Enclose the following: • Processing fees of RM25 in the form of bank draft or postal order made payable to UNITEM Sdn Bhd (RM15 for online application) • 2 sets of certified IC copies, all academic certificates and transcripts • 1 RM0.30 stamp 3) Applicants are encouraged to apply online @ www.oum.edu.my

OUM LEARNING METHODOLOGY

Learners choose the nearest location as their learning centres and the number of subjects per semester. We offer a flexible blended mode of learning.

SELF-MANAGED LEARNING

Where learners study independently according to their time availability.

Established on August 10, 2000 Open University Malaysia (OUM) is the seventh private university in Malaysia. OUM leverages on the quality, prestige and capabilities of its owners - a consortium of the 11 Malaysian public universities. Striving on its motto of a “University For All” OUM subscribes to the philosophy that education should be made available to all, regardless of time, place and age.

ON-LINE LEARNING

Electronic communication tools such as e-mail, bulletin board and chat rooms are provided to facilitate interaction among learners, tutors and facilitators.

FACE-TO-FACE INTERACTION

Face-to-face tutorial sessions are conducted at Learning Centres during weekends or after office hours.
